Output 26814a0e21baedc555fd549c4b55a2d04fa12126b4221b08b027b2042e7b0b0a:0

value
1068197
script pubkey
OP_0 OP_PUSHBYTES_20 c3fa1d595c4ac83b7af9be48feece9d66926f269
address
bc1qc0ap6k2uftyrk7hehey0am8f6e5jdunf07cyfk
transaction
26814a0e21baedc555fd549c4b55a2d04fa12126b4221b08b027b2042e7b0b0a
spent
true